[quote name='chunga']Is the Hori Fightstick 3 good for an average-intermediate player like myself?[/QUOTE]

i'd say i'm an average/intermediate player and i really didn't like the hori ex2 which is basically the 360 version of the fightstick 3. i'd say try to get a fightstick SE that way you can use the stock parts, and when they no longer satisfy, quality replacements are easier to swap in than on an ex2 or fs3.
 
[quote name='chunga']Is the Hori Fightstick 3 good for an average-intermediate player like myself?[/QUOTE]


They are decent once you swap out the guts, but they are typically built with lesser parts than even the EX2. i have an EX2 that i put Sanwa Buttons and GT-Y gate and it feels pretty good other than the microswitches on the joystick. Once you swap out at least the buttons its decent, but i agree with Milky try to get your hands on something nicer like the SE or a HRAP
